Q. How is the NTFS namespace planned? Explain.

Answer: The NTFS namespace is prearranged as a hierarchy of directories where every directory uses a B+ tree data structure to store an index of the file names in that directory. The index root of a directory encloses the top level of the B+ tree. Every entry in the directory contains the name as well as files reference of the file as well as the update timestamp and file size.
